Holland & Barrett is located in Letterkenny, Ireland on Centre Buildings, Unit 3 Lower Main St. Holland & Barrett is rated 4.1 out of 5 in the category health food store in Ireland.
Address
Centre Buildings, Unit 3 Lower Main St
Accessibility
Wheelchair-accessible car parkWheelchair-accessible entrance